Bastille Day was a crazy one; The French know how to have a public holiday! Much like 4th July celebrations in the USA, July 14th sees the locals take to the streets and celebrate the great history of France and it's Revoultion. Even better, Iggy Pop was playing in Lyon's Roman Amphitheater ; the old dilapidated sight was very impressive, and the Amphitheater was pretty sweet!

But Iggy wasn't the only thing going on throughut Wednesyda; it seemed  ahabbit that small children had managed to get ahold of fireworks, crackers and bangers and were recreating scenes which looked like a wizard duel out of a Harry Potter movie. The number of tmes I expected to be hit by a small child's misguided mini firework was numerous that I was quite cautious walking through Lyon come nightfall.

Luckily I survived the day and as I sat in front of the Hotel de Ville and watched the fireworks explode over the Basilica I couldn't help but be grateful that I had survived the day without gaining third degree burns.
